Nightingale At Arkadelphia is one of the top-rated nursing facilities in Arkadelphia, Arkansas, earning an A grade based on CMS data. With a score of 90/100, it ranks in the top 13% of facilities statewide — a strong indicator of quality care.

Staffing at Nightingale At Arkadelphia is near the national average, with 3.85 total nursing hours per resident per day (national average: 3.8 hours).

Recent inspections identified 9 deficiencies at Nightingale At Arkadelphia. While none were classified as the most serious level, families should review the detailed inspection history below.
